通过优化 Debian 系统中的 `readdir` 操作,可以显著提升服务器的性能,尤其是在处理大量文件和目录时。以下是一些具体的方法和最佳实践: ### 1. **升级系统和内核** 确保你的 ...
**Ubuntu打包Golang应用的工具推荐** **一 核心工具清单** - **Go 自带工具链**:使用**go build**生成可执行文件;配合环境变量**GOOS/GOARCH/CGO...
在Ubuntu系统中,使用Golang编译打包后的文件通常位于当前工作目录下。当你使用`go build`命令编译一个Go程序时,它会生成一个可执行文件,该文件位于你运行`go build`命令的目录...
**Golang 在 Ubuntu 打包的常见问题与对策** **一 构建与依赖管理** - 使用 **Go Modules** 管理依赖,确保版本可控:在项目根目录执行 **go mod init...
在Ubuntu下使用Golang进行打包时,可能会遇到一些难点。以下是一些常见的问题及解决方法: 1. 依赖管理:Golang项目通常依赖于多个外部库。在打包过程中,需要确保所有依赖项都已正确安装。...
**Golang 在 Ubuntu 的打包流程优化** **一 构建与产物优化** - 使用 **Go Modules** 管理依赖,执行 **go mod tidy** 清理无用依赖,减少不必要的...
**Ubuntu打包Golang代码的方法** **一 准备环境** - 安装 Go(Ubuntu 仓库或官方安装包均可): - 仓库安装:`sudo apt-get update && sud...
在Ubuntu下,要使Docker容器在退出时自动重启,可以使用`--restart`选项。当你使用`docker run`命令创建一个新的容器时,可以添加`--restart`参数来指定重启策略。以...
**Ubuntu 上 Docker 镜像共享的常用方式** - **离线导出导入 tar 包**:用 **docker save** 导出为 **.tar**,通过 **scp/rsync/USB*...
在Ubuntu下使用Docker容器时,持久化数据是一个常见的需求。以下是几种常见的方法来实现数据持久化: ### 1. 使用卷(Volumes) Docker卷是最推荐的数据持久化方法,因为它们提...